The combined use of high fluoride (F-) concentration and acidic pH can weaken the corrosion resistance of titanium (Ti). Caries prophylactic products contain high amounts of F- and are applied at a low pH. The aim of our study was to determine whether the different forms of applied flouride has different effects on the growth of Streptococcus mutans on different titanium surfaces. Titanium with polished surface were treated with a gel (pH: 4,8) containing 1,25% olaflur, a rinse (pH: 4,4) containing 0,025% olaflur or a 1% aqueous solution of NaF at a pH of 4,5. Control discs were not treated. All discs were incubated with S. mutans for 21 days. To assess the amount of S. mutans protein assay analysis was performed at 5, 10 and 21 days. Scanning electron microscopic (SEM) investigations were also executed. By the 21st day significant differences could be observed in the bacterial protein quantity. The between group- comparisons showed that the rinse and gel were superior to NaF or control group (p < 0,01 and p < 0,05). Furthermore signs of corrosion could be observed in the group of gel treated discs. The results suggest that amine-fluoride content mouthwashes might be a suitable choice for prevention to the patients with dental implants.

Our objective was to assess the literature regarding the accuracy of the different static guided systems. After applying electronic literature search we found 661 articles. After reviewing 139 articles, the authors chose 52 articles for full-text evaluation. 24 studies involved accuracy measurements. Fourteen of our selected references were clinical and ten of them were in vitro (modell or cadaver). Variance-analysis (Tukey's post-hoc test; p < 0.05) was conducted to summarize the selected publications. Regarding 2819 results the average mean error at the entry point was 0.98 mm. At the level of the apex the average deviation was 1.29 mm while the mean of the angular deviation was 3,96 degrees. Significant difference could be observed between the two methods of implant placement (partially and fully guided sequence) in terms of deviation at the entry point, apex and angular deviation. Different levels of quality and quantity of evidence were available for assessing the accuracy of the different computer-assisted implant placement. The rapidly evolving field of digital dentistry and the new developments will further improve the accuracy of guided implant placement. In the interest of being able to draw dependable conclusions and for the further evaluation of the parameters used for accuracy measurements, randomized, controlled single or multi-centered clinical trials are necessary.
